Stretchable electronic skin lets robotic hand feel touch and pressure signals

SMRTR summary

Researchers at Finland's University of Turku created a stretchable, transparent electronic skin that enables robots to sense touch and pressure. The eco-friendly material could improve prosthetics, soft robotics, and human-machine interfaces.
